Cops: Mattituck woman stole wallets at church

Pumillo

Southold Town police arrested a Mattituck woman who allegedly stole people’s wallets from a Mattituck church in December as well as a local library. 

Sibel L. Pumillo, 26, was charged with four counts of petit larceny, all misdemeanors, and is suspected of similar thefts in Riverhead Town and further west into the Suffolk County Police District, Southold Town police said.

Ms. Pumillo was processed and released on bail to appear in Southold Town court later this month, police said.

Ms. Pumillo was arrested in October 2014 on similar charges for allegedly stealing purses from women who work at Advent Lutheran Church.
